Before today's game against Houston, the Atlanta Braves made a roster transaction. Daybsel Hernandez was designated with right shoulder inflammation. The injury description is vague and could range from minor rest to serious structural damage. Hernandez returned for only one appearance, during which the Seattle Mariners hit two home runs off him. The Mariners collectively shelled the Braves pitching last weekend, and Hernandez may need an IL stint. Hunter Stratton was recalled to Atlanta despite a 6.57 ERA. Stratton recently allowed two hits and a run while recording no outs in Nashville.
